Guidance on Visual Documentation of Zumba Sessions

This section provides essential guidance on the appropriate use and creation of photographic content related to Zumba classes. Adherence to these guidelines ensures respectful and effective representation of the activity and its participants.

Tip 1: Obtain Explicit Consent: Prior to capturing images of individuals participating in Zumba, secure their explicit consent. Ensure participants understand how the photographs will be used and retain the right to withdraw their consent at any time.

Tip 2: Maintain Professionalism: Photographic content should maintain a high standard of professionalism. Avoid images that are suggestive, exploitative, or that may objectify participants. Focus on capturing the energy and fitness aspects of the activity.

Tip 3: Respect Cultural Sensitivities: Be mindful of cultural norms and sensitivities regarding dress and physical activity. Ensure that the images are appropriate for a diverse audience.

Tip 4: Ensure Adequate Lighting: Proper lighting is essential for high-quality photographs. Use natural light whenever possible, or supplement with artificial lighting to avoid harsh shadows or glare.

Tip 5: Focus on Authentic Representation: Strive to capture the genuine experience of a Zumba class. Avoid excessive posing or staging, and focus on candid moments of participants engaging in the activity.

Tip 6: Adhere to Copyright Laws: Ensure that any music or branding featured in the photographs is used in compliance with copyright laws. Obtain necessary permissions or licenses as required.

Tip 7: Anonymize Where Necessary: In situations where consent is not obtainable from all participants, anonymize their identities. This may involve blurring faces or focusing on group shots from a distance.

Effective and ethical visual documentation of Zumba classes requires careful consideration of participant rights, cultural sensitivities, and legal requirements. Adherence to these guidelines promotes respectful and accurate representation of the activity.

Question 1: What are the primary ethical considerations when photographing Zumba classes?

The primary ethical considerations encompass obtaining informed consent from all individuals featured in the photographs, respecting cultural sensitivities regarding attire and physical activity, and ensuring that the images are not used in a manner that is exploitative or objectifies participants.

Question 2: How does the representation of participant demographics impact the perceived accessibility of Zumba programs?

The visual depiction of participant demographics, including age, gender, cultural background, and body type, directly influences the program’s perceived inclusivity. A diverse representation signals accessibility to a wider audience, while a lack thereof may deter participation.

Question 3: What constitutes appropriate attire for visual representations of Zumba classes?

Appropriate attire should be functional for the activity, allowing for unrestricted movement, and respectful of cultural norms. Overly revealing or suggestive clothing is generally considered inappropriate for promotional materials and may be perceived as objectifying participants.

Question 4: How can visual content effectively convey the energy and enthusiasm of a Zumba class?

Capturing the energy and enthusiasm requires showcasing active engagement, dynamic movements, and positive facial expressions. Candid shots that reflect the joy and intensity of the workout are more effective than posed or staged images.

Question 5: What legal considerations are relevant when using photographs of Zumba classes for promotional purposes?

Legal considerations include obtaining model releases from all identifiable individuals in the photographs, ensuring compliance with copyright laws regarding music and branding, and adhering to advertising regulations concerning truthfulness and accuracy.

Question 6: How can instructors use visual content to enhance their teaching and communication skills?

Instructors can utilize visual content to demonstrate proper form and technique, provide visual cues for specific movements, and create a more engaging and dynamic learning environment. Videos and photographs can supplement verbal instructions and clarify complex routines.
